You need to focus on a single idea/goal...

Everybody wants insane horsepower and be perfectly reliable...and that is the reason supercars cost as much as they do.

If you really want a car that is "so fast it is scary to drive" you got the wrong car. Pick up an old Fox body Mustang, drop in a 408 or a built 331, put on a blower and you will be running low to mid 10's all day...trust me when I say that is plenty scary for the street.

But if high 12's/low 13's is enough to scare you, then I would say that your goal is more realistic.

The highest whp people are making right now is a bit north of 400whp due to fueling issues. Without a lot of money to make it worthwhile to them for time and expenses for more R&D, it's going to be difficult to get more than that.

We get emails like this all the time. People want more power than evryone else is making for less money than many are spending and they want it to be more reliable than modified cars generally are. Realistically, how far is $6k going to go? We could do a turbo swap kit for about $2500. With $1000 for installation and extensive tuning, it would be at $3500. Add in the required clutch and install for $1500 and we are already at $5k. A 3" catback installed will run more than $500. At this point, you are looking at $5500 and coming in around 400whp. 500whp will require a larger turbo adding $500. An external fuel system and modified intake manifold will run $1500 and add $1000 install and tuning. That puts you at $8k. Upgraded charge tubes and a large FMIC will run about $1500 installed, bringing you to $9500. A ported head with installation, springs, gaskets, fluids, will run $2000+, which brings the total to $11,500. This setup should be capable of 500whp. Unfortunately, it would be a stretch to call it streetable and not likely to be reliable considering the stock bottom end and transmission are still in place.
